Trait: response to statin

Trait Information
Identifier GO_0036273
Description Any process that results in a change in state or activity of a cell or an organism (in terms of movement, secretion, enzyme production, gene expression, etc.) as a result of a statin stimulus. Statins are organooxygen compounds whose structure is related to compactin (mevastatin) and which may be used as an anticholesteremic drug due its EC:1.1.1.34/EC:1.1.1.88 (hydroxymethylglutaryl-CoA reductase) inhibitory properties. [GOC: hp]
Trait category
Biological process
Synonyms 2 synonyms
  • response to HMG-CoA reductase inhibitor
  • response to hydroxymethylglutaryl-CoA reductase inhibitor
